What Exactly Are Small Pitch Sprockets?

In simple terms, a sprocket is a wheel with teeth that mesh with a chain to transfer motion and power. The "pitch"​ refers to the distance between the centers of two adjacent teeth on the sprocket . When we talk about small pitch sprockets, we're referring to sprockets with a relatively short distance between teeth—common examples include pitches like 1/4 inch (6.35mm) or even smaller, such as 0.1475 inches .

These sprockets are typically used with smaller-sized chains and are characterized by their compact design. Due to the small pitch, the overall drive system can be more lightweight and space-efficient . This makes them ideal for applications where space is limited and precise movement is critical.

Key Advantages: Why Choose Small Pitch Sprockets?

You might be asking, "Why should I care about the pitch size?" Well, the benefits are quite significant:

  • Smoother and Quieter Operation: Because the chain engages with more teeth in a single rotation, the speed variation is reduced. This results in less impact and noise, making these sprockets perfect for environments where quiet operation is desired . Think about office equipment or precision instruments—no one wants a noisy machine disrupting the workflow!

  • Ideal for High-Speed Applications: These sprockets are well-suited for high-speed conveyor systems and other machinery where rapid movement is essential . The design allows for efficient power transmission at higher RPMs.

  • Compact and Lightweight Designs: Their small size enables engineers to create more streamlined and space-saving machinery . This is a huge advantage in robotics, small-scale automation, and consumer electronics where every millimeter counts .

  • Precision Control: They offer excellent positional accuracy with low backlash, which is crucial for applications like instrument drives and automated systems where precise movement is non-negotiable .

Where You'll Find Them: Common Applications

Small pitch sprockets are everywhere once you start looking! Here are some common use cases:

  • Conveyor Systems: Especially high-speed conveyors in packaging, bottling, or assembly lines .

  • Office Equipment and Appliances: Inside printers, copiers, and small household appliances where quiet and reliable operation is key.

  • Robotics and Automation: Critical for the precise joint movements in robotic arms and automated guided vehicles (AGVs) .

  • Precision Instruments: Used in medical devices, photographic equipment, and measuring instruments .


Choosing the Right Small Pitch Sprocket: A Quick Guide

Selecting the right sprocket isn't just about size. Here’s a quick checklist to guide you:

  • Match the Chain: This is the most critical step! The sprocket's pitch must perfectly match​ the chain's pitch. Common small chain sizes include #25 (1/4" pitch) and other fine-pitch chains . A mismatch will cause rapid wear and failure.

  • Consider the Material: Sprockets can be made from various materials.

    • Steel: Offers high strength and durability for heavy-duty industrial applications .

    • Stainless Steel: Provides excellent corrosion resistance, ideal for harsh environments or food processing .

    • Plastics (like Nylon or POM): These are lightweight, corrosion-resistant, and operate quietly. They are great for lighter loads, food-grade applications, or where minimal maintenance is desired .

  • Check the Tooth Count: The number of teeth affects the speed and torque of the system. A sprocket with more teeth will provide smoother operation and higher speed reduction .

  • Understand the Load Requirements: Evaluate the torque and weight the sprocket needs to handle. While small pitch sprockets are excellent for precision, they have lower load capacities compared to their larger-pitch counterparts .
